92 protege stall and no start
I have a 92 protege DOHC. The distributor, coil, MAFS, plugs and wires, fuel system cleaner have all been replaced and performed. My problem is that it will start running poorly and stumble on acceleration and not rev well. When turned off or allowed to stall (with clutch in) it will take a long time (probably 30+ minutes to restart). This is when it is at operating temp. What could be the problem? RE: 92 protege stall and no start
How does fuel pressure look. Should be around 34psi with vacuum line to pressure regulator connected and around 42 with line disconnected. Also check to make sure regulator diaphram is not ruptured and fuel is being sucked straight into the intake from the vacuum line.
